52EThe Ecclesiastical Judges, Legal Officers and Others (Fees) Order 2017 is amended as follows.
Commencement Information
I1Sch. 3 para. 52 in force at 1.9.2018 by S.I. 2018/720, art. 2
53EIn article 1 (the title to which becomes “ Citation, commencement and interpretation ”), after paragraph (3) insert—
“(4)In this Order, “the 2018 Measure” means the Ecclesiastical Jurisdiction and Care of Churches Measure 2018.”
Commencement Information
I2Sch. 3 para. 53 in force at 1.9.2018 by S.I. 2018/720, art. 2
54(1)Article 2 (faculty fees payable to diocesan boards of finance) is amended as follows.E
(2)In paragraph (1), for “section 3(2) of the Care of Places of Worship Measure 1999” substitute “ section 43(1) of the 2018 Measure ”.
(3)In paragraph (4)(a), for “section 1(2)(e) of the Care of Places of Worship Measure 1999” substitute “ section 38(2)(e) of the 2018 Measure ”.
Commencement Information
I3Sch. 3 para. 54 in force at 1.9.2018 by S.I. 2018/720, art. 2
55EIn article 3 (register of patrons), in paragraph (2), for “section 5(1) of the Ecclesiastical Fees Measure 1986” substitute “ section 86(1) and (3) of the 2018 Measure ”.
Commencement Information
I4Sch. 3 para. 55 in force at 1.9.2018 by S.I. 2018/720, art. 2
56(1)Article 4 (proceedings in consistory court) is amended as follows.E
(2)In paragraph (2), in Table 1—
(a)in the entry for item 2, for “section 13 of the Care of Churches and Ecclesiastical Jurisdiction Measure 1991 (“the 1991 Measure”)” substitute “ section 71 or 72 of the 2018 Measure ”,
(b)in the entry for item 3, for “section 13 of the 1991 Measure” substitute “ section 71 or 72 of the 2018 Measure ”, and
(c)in the entry for item 4, for “section 18 of the 1991 Measure” substitute “ section 63 of the 2018 Measure ”.
(3)In paragraph (6), for “section 3(5)(a) of the Care of Places of Worship Measure 1999” substitute “ section 43(3) of the 2018 Measure ”.
Commencement Information
I5Sch. 3 para. 56 in force at 1.9.2018 by S.I. 2018/720, art. 2
57EIn article 5 (appeals from consistory court), in paragraph (2), in Table 2, in the entry for item 1, for “section 10(3) of the Ecclesiastical Jurisdiction Measure 1963” substitute “ section 18(4) of the 2018 Measure ”.
Commencement Information
I6Sch. 3 para. 57 in force at 1.9.2018 by S.I. 2018/720, art. 2
58EIn article 7 (proceedings in Vicar-General's court), in paragraph (3), for “section 62 of the Ecclesiastical Jurisdiction Measure 1963” substitute “ section 20B of the Care of Cathedrals Measure 2011 ”.
Commencement Information
I7Sch. 3 para. 58 in force at 1.9.2018 by S.I. 2018/720, art. 2
59(1)Article 9 (proceedings on review of finding of Court of Ecclesiastical Causes Reserved) is amended as follows.E
(2)In paragraph (1), after “(“the 1963 Measure”)” insert “ or section 19 of the 2018 Measure ”.
(3)In paragraph (3)(b), for “proceedings on a case of the kind referred to in section 11(2)(b) of that Measure” substitute “ proceedings under section 19 of the 2018 Measure ”.
Commencement Information
I8Sch. 3 para. 59 in force at 1.9.2018 by S.I. 2018/720, art. 2
60EIn article 12 (miscellaneous fees), in paragraph (2), for “section 8 of the Ecclesiastical Fees Measure 1986” substitute “ section 86(6) of the 2018 Measure ”.
Commencement Information
I9Sch. 3 para. 60 in force at 1.9.2018 by S.I. 2018/720, art. 2
